Baked Dark Chocolate
Baked dark chocolate is a rich, indulgent treat made from cocoa solids, cocoa butter, and sugar, often used in desserts and confections. It is known for its deep flavor and potential health benefits due to its high antioxidant content.
Air-Popped Beef Jerky
Air-popped beef jerky is a high-protein snack made from lean cuts of beef that have been dehydrated to remove moisture while preserving flavor and nutrients. It is a convenient source of protein, ideal for on-the-go snacking.
